Honestly, Windows 8 differs from Windows 7 primarily in the user interface. Most underlying infrastructure stuff are the same. The new UI in Windows 8 is known as Metro. The Metro Start screen displays applications as rectangular icons so you can touch or click an application to launch it. The Desktop application hosts the traditional Windows 7 interface for supporting older application environment. Launching the Desktop application from the Start screen can enter into the Desktop mode, which looks like the traditional desktop interface. The traditional Start Menu has been "replaced" by the Start screen which is like a fullscreen presentation of the Start Menu. You need to know that Windows 8 is designed to work more seamlessly on touch-enabled display! One thing special about Metro application is that they cannot be resized on screen.
